Hi Im a bit lost with your versions, can you check tomee 1.5.1? ( and maybe trunk) Le 30 déc. 2012 08:27, "Enrico Olivelli" <eolive...@gmail.com> a écrit :
> may I create an issue in JIRA for this problem ? > > it actually blocks me, I cannot upgrade apps on production environment > without refactoring file system layouts > > thank you > Enrico > > > Il 28/12/2012 15:53, Enrico Olivelli - Diennea ha scritto: > >> Hi all, >> I can deploy a webapp as ROOT context putting my webapp code in >> TOMEEDIR/webapps/ROOT >> >> But I cannot deploy ita s ROOT if I use this deployment scenario: >> >> - Put my webapp on /opt/myapp >> >> - Put TOMEEDIR/conf/Catalina/**localhost/ROOT.xml with <Context >> docBase='/opt/myapp' path='' > >> >> I'm using Tomee 1.1 >> http://svn.apache.org/repos/**asf/openejb/tags/openejb-4.5.** >> 1/tomee/tomee-catalina/src/**main/java/org/apache/tomee/** >> catalina/OpenEJBContextConfig.**java<http://svn.apache.org/repos/asf/openejb/tags/openejb-4.5.1/tomee/tomee-catalina/src/main/java/org/apache/tomee/catalina/OpenEJBContextConfig.java> >> >> on TomEE 1.0 (openejb 4.5) method processAnnotationsUrl was really >> different >> http://svn.apache.org/repos/**asf/openejb/tags/openejb-4.5.** >> 0/tomee/tomee-catalina/src/**main/java/org/apache/tomee/** >> catalina/OpenEJBContextConfig.**java<http://svn.apache.org/repos/asf/openejb/tags/openejb-4.5.0/tomee/tomee-catalina/src/main/java/org/apache/tomee/catalina/OpenEJBContextConfig.java> >> >> I found a workaround: >> >> - Put my webapp on /opt/myapp/ROOT >> >> - Put TOMEEDIR/conf/Catalina/**localhost/ROOT.xml with <Context >> docBase='/opt/myapp/ROOT' path='' > >> >> What do you think ? >> >> Thank you >> >> >> this is the deployment error >> org.apache.catalina.**LifecycleException: Failed to start component >> [StandardEngine[Catalina].**StandardHost[localhost].**StandardContext[]] >> at org.apache.catalina.util.**LifecycleBase.start(** >> LifecycleBase.java:154) >> at org.apache.catalina.core.**ContainerBase.**addChildInternal(* >> *ContainerBase.java:901) >> at org.apache.catalina.core.**ContainerBase.addChild(** >> ContainerBase.java:877) >> at org.apache.catalina.core.**StandardHost.addChild(** >> StandardHost.java:633) >> at org.apache.catalina.startup.**HostConfig.deployDescriptor(** >> HostConfig.java:657) >> at org.apache.catalina.startup.**HostConfig$DeployDescriptor.** >> run(HostConfig.java:1637) >> at java.util.concurrent.**Executors$RunnableAdapter.** >> call(Executors.java:471) >> at java.util.concurrent.**FutureTask$Sync.innerRun(** >> FutureTask.java:334) >> at java.util.concurrent.**FutureTask.run(FutureTask.**java:166) >> at java.util.concurrent.**ThreadPoolExecutor.runWorker(** >> ThreadPoolExecutor.java:1110) >> at java.util.concurrent.**ThreadPoolExecutor$Worker.run(** >> ThreadPoolExecutor.java:603) >> at java.lang.Thread.run(Thread.**java:722) >> Caused by: java.lang.**IllegalArgumentException: can't find path under >> current webapp deployment [] >> at org.apache.tomee.catalina.**OpenEJBContextConfig.** >> processAnnotationsUrl(**OpenEJBContextConfig.java:297) >> at org.apache.catalina.startup.**ContextConfig.webConfig(** >> ContextConfig.java:1306) >> at org.apache.tomee.catalina.**OpenEJBContextConfig.**webConfig( >> **OpenEJBContextConfig.java:188) >> at org.apache.catalina.startup.**ContextConfig.configureStart(** >> ContextConfig.java:878) >> at org.apache.tomee.catalina.**OpenEJBContextConfig.** >> configureStart(**OpenEJBContextConfig.java:76) >> at org.apache.catalina.startup.**ContextConfig.lifecycleEvent(** >> ContextConfig.java:369) >> at org.apache.catalina.util.**LifecycleSupport.** >> fireLifecycleEvent(**LifecycleSupport.java:119) >> at org.apache.catalina.util.**LifecycleBase.** >> fireLifecycleEvent(**LifecycleBase.java:90) >> at org.apache.catalina.core.**StandardContext.startInternal(** >> StandardContext.java:5173) >> at org.apache.catalina.util.**LifecycleBase.start(** >> LifecycleBase.java:150) >> ... 11 more >> >> >> >> >> >> Enrico Olivelli >> Software Development Manager @Diennea >> Tel.: (+39) 0546 667432 - Int. 925 >> Viale G.Marconi 30/14 - 48018 Faenza (RA) >> >> MagNews - E-mail Marketing Solutions >> http://www.magnews.it<http://**www.magnews.it/ <http://www.magnews.it/>> >> Diennea - Digital Marketing Solutions >> http://www.diennea.com<http://**www.diennea.com/<http://www.diennea.com/> >> > >> >> >> >> >> ______________________________**__ >> Scarica la ricerca completa di MagNews "Digital Marketing Trends 2012" >> Quali sono le percezioni relative all'utilizzo dell'email privata e >> aziendale da parte degli utenti internet italiani? E' cambiato qualcosa >> rispetto al 2011? >> http://www.magnews.it/it/**risorse/ricerche/digital-**marketing-trends<http://www.magnews.it/it/risorse/ricerche/digital-marketing-trends> >> >> >